The Gift of Music
The Motor City Lyric Opera is a non-profit organization dedicated to inspiring and educating students and families in the metropolitan Detroit area, in particular the underserved, through highly artistic musical presentations. We believe that the expression of the arts is a humanistic universal right that transcends social and economic boundaries, and should be available to everyone.
Through our colorful, captivating, and values-focused programs, we strive to inspire and elevate the hearts and minds of metropolitan Detroit.
Traditions
The Amahl and the Night Visitors holiday performance has become a tradition for many families. The Motor City Lyric Opera has entertained more than 60,000 students free of charge—many of whom had never before seen a live theatrical performance. We provided many additional free tickets to community groups.
We will continue to bring this affordable and accessible holiday event to our growing list of members and strive to make it a Detroit centerpiece of holiday events for everyone.
Inspiration and Hope
As state budgets and school funding are slashed, school arts programs are frequently the first to be cut. The Motor City Lyric Opera believes aspirations and dreams that inspire future generations become limited when exposure to the arts is reduced or completely lost. Through Opera on Wheels, our outreach program, we bring interactive opera productions with themes of inspiration and hope, encouraging children to reflect on how we treat each other.
